967,288 is a composite number, even.
967,288 (nine hundred sixty-seven thousand two hundred eighty-eight) is an even 6-digit number. It is a composite number with 32 divisors, and factors as 2³ × 7 × 23 × 751. Its proper divisors sum to 1,198,472, more than the number itself, making it an abundant number.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0xEC278.
